Competitiveness: A Shifting Landscape
While EM may have been easier to enter in the past‚ Reddit users suggest it’s becoming more competitive for both MD and DO applicants. Factors like mid-level encroachment and increasing residency spots raise concerns. However‚ community EM programs still offer opportunities for average candidates.
Key Factors Influencing Competitiveness
- USMLE Scores: The mean USMLE Step 2 CK score is around 247.
- Program Length: EM residencies are relatively short.
- Lifestyle: EM is generally considered a low-stress lifestyle.

Navigating the Application Process
Reddit threads often delve into strategies for maximizing your chances of matching into an EM program. Key takeaways include:
- Strong Letters of Recommendation: Cultivate relationships with faculty and seek out impactful letters that highlight your clinical abilities and work ethic.
- EM Rotations: Excel during your EM rotations. Demonstrate a proactive approach‚ a willingness to learn‚ and the ability to work effectively under pressure.
- Personal Statement: Craft a compelling narrative that showcases your passion for EM‚ your relevant experiences‚ and your long-term goals.
- Residency Program Research: Utilize resources like EMRA (Emergency Medicine Residents’ Association) to research residency programs and identify those that align with your interests and qualifications. Consider factors like program size‚ location‚ curriculum‚ and faculty expertise.
- Interview Skills: Practice your interview skills to effectively communicate your strengths‚ personality‚ and interest in the program. Prepare thoughtful questions to ask the interviewers.
Addressing the Concerns
While the pay is generally considered good‚ Reddit also acknowledges the potential downsides of EM‚ such as burnout‚ shift work‚ and exposure to challenging situations. Some users express concern about future job security and the impact of mid-level providers. These concerns highlight the importance of carefully considering the long-term implications of choosing EM as a career path.

The Importance of Finding Your Niche Within EM
As the field of emergency medicine evolves‚ specialization is becoming increasingly common. Reddit users often discuss the benefits of pursuing fellowships in areas like:
- Critical Care: For those drawn to managing the sickest patients in the ED.
- EMS (Emergency Medical Services): Combining clinical practice with prehospital care and disaster response.
- Pediatric Emergency Medicine: Focusing on the unique needs of children in the emergency setting.
- Ultrasound: Mastering point-of-care ultrasound for rapid diagnosis and procedural guidance.
- Toxicology: Specializing in the management of poisonings and overdoses.
Pursuing a fellowship can enhance your career prospects‚ provide specialized skills‚ and allow you to carve out a unique niche within the broader field of EM.
The DO Perspective on Emergency Medicine Competitiveness
Reddit provides a platform for DO (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ine) students and physicians to share their experiences. While DO applicants may face some additional hurdles compared to MD applicants‚ many successful DOs have matched into competitive EM programs. Key strategies for DO applicants include:
- Excellent COMLEX Scores: Aim for high scores on the COMLEX exams to demonstrate academic proficiency.
- USMLE Scores (Optional but Recommended): Taking the USMLE exams can broaden your application pool and demonstrate competitiveness.
- Strong Clinical Rotations: Excel during your rotations‚ particularly in EM‚ and seek out opportunities to work with MD attendings.
- Highlight Osteopathic Philosophy: Showcase how your osteopathic training has shaped your approach to patient care.
With hard work‚ dedication‚ and a strategic approach‚ DO students can successfully match into competitive EM residencies.
